Optimas is seeking an experienced, driven candidate to fill the role of Senior Strategic Sourcing Manager on our dynamic team based in Wood Dale, Illinois. This position reports directly to the Senior Director, Strategic Sourcing and will oversee the externally threaded (aka Male Threaded) fastener category and a team of 2-3 sourcing managers. The ideal candidate for this position has strong procurement and analytical experience, preferably in the fastener industry, combined with the vision to create actionable sourcing strategies. In this role the candidate will be responsible for developing category goals, the identification of tactics to achieve them and, through the efforts of a dedicated sourcing team, the execution of cost savings programs. A candidate for this position must be a creative problem-solver who thrives in a dynamic environment, an analytical thinker who is able to make competent decisions and not shy away from difficult situations that may arise with key supply partners.

Responsibilities

  • Strategy Development – Develop sourcing strategies for the assigned category based on rigorous analysis of spend data, supply market dynamics, category intelligence, and business requirements.
  • Tactics Identification – “how do we get there” roadmaps with accountability and timeliness.
  • Use of Strategic Sourcing toolset – 7-step method, market analyses, key supplier selection, vendor and spend consolidation, tender issuance and management, and execution of tender outcomes.
  • Communication Skills – Exceptionally strong written and oral communication skills are necessary. Position may join in presenting plans and results to senior management as well as colleagues across the business.
  • Negotiations – Strong negotiations skills are required; formal training is preferred.
  • Must be able to read and write complex supply contracts, including liaising with Legal department as necessary.
  • Information Resource – understand material cost changes and relevant market dynamics within the assigned category and provide stakeholders with relevant and timely updates.
  • Technical Skills – an understanding of manufacturing practices used for products within the category and the ability to understand product specifications and features (i.e. cold heading, secondary finishes, etc.). Experience in cold heading or other metalworking industries will be viewed favorably.
  • Analytical Skills – Enjoy gathering and digging deeply into data to identify issues and creative, effective solutions.
  • Partner with Customer and Supplier Quality managers to drive continuous supply base improvement in the category, including external benchmarking and the use of KPI’s to monitor compliance to Optimas requirements.
  • Lead cost recovery and defective material disposition with responsible vendors.
